Located in the southeastern Pacific Ocean, Easter Island is renowned for its clear waters and underwater visibility that can reach up to 60 meters. Divers can explore volcanic formations, caves, and a unique underwater moai statue among the marine life that includes coral, lobsters, and various species of fish. This remote island offers a truly unique diving experience.
